The Administrative Assistant is responsible for a variety of administrative and clerical tasks. Duties include providing support to our managers and employees, assisting in daily office needs and managing the departments general administrative activities.
The weekday schedule is flexible, but the candidate must have weekend availability. The pay range is $22 - $25/hr depending on experience.
- Answer and direct phone calls
- Prepare files for different procedures
- Data entry into Electronic Medical Records
- Enter SART information to complete patient information
- Provide general support to visitors
- Assist with Ovation website inquiries
- Process documentation by scanning and filing necessary forms
- Arrange shipping of specimens to other facilities
- Maintain department reports
